Hawaiian Roll French Toast

  • Total Time: 20 minutes
  • Yield: 6 servings
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Ingredients

  • 4 large eggs
  • ½ cup milk (whole milk or any dairy/non-dairy alternative)
  • 1 tablespoon vanilla extract
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• ⅛ teaspoon nutmeg
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 12 Hawaiian rolls, sliced horizontally (e.g., King’s Hawaiian sweet rolls)
  • Confectioners’ sugar (optional, for serving)
  • Maple syrup (optional, for serving)

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Egg Mixture: Whisk together eggs, milk, vanilla, cinnamon, salt, and nutmeg in a large bowl until well combined.
  2. Heat the Cooking Surface: Preheat a griddle or skillet over medium heat and coat with 1 tablespoon of butter.
  3. Dip the Rolls: Dip each halved Hawaiian roll into the egg mixture until coated, shaking off excess liquid.
  4. Cook the Rolls: Place rolls on the griddle and cook for 2–3 minutes per side until golden brown. Flip and repeat for the other side.
  5. Repeat: Continue cooking in batches, adding more butter to the griddle as needed.
  6. Serve: Sprinkle with confectioners’ sugar and drizzle with maple syrup. Serve warm.

Notes

  • For a tropical twist, add pineapple juice to the egg mixture.
  • Substitute dairy milk with almond or coconut milk for a dairy-free version.
  • To avoid sogginess, ensure the rolls are only lightly dipped in the custard mixture.
